About Barclays

Barclays is a British universal bank. We are diversified by business, by different types of customers and clients, and by geography.

Our businesses include consumer banking and payments operations around the world, as well as a top-tier, full service, global corporate and investment bank, all of which are supported by our service company which provides technology, operations and functional services across the Group.

Introduction


Regulatory Capital Reporting is a team within Risk which provides both strategic and functional leadership to the reporting of capital metrics across the Barclays Group.


Its core responsibilities are to:
1. Ensure that Regulatory Capital Reporting develops, maintains and produces comprehensive and effective analysis and top-level reporting of Capital;


  • Support the analysis required; and,
  • Undertake a critical review of the material supplied by businesses within Regulatory Capital Management, and, after consultation with them, arrive at an accurate and agreed content.
  • Understand, implement own funds and capital requirements for Investment and Corporate Bank products and portfolios. It must specifically cover large exposures, securitisations, counterparty credit risk, wholesale credit risk, corporate bank credit risk, leverage and supervisory reporting complaint to Regulatory text part of CRR and applicable regulations for Barclays.
